Valcamonica, Foppe di Nadro - Rock 35

Description

A smaller surface in relation to the many very large carved rocks at Foppe di Nadro. The rock has been extensively smoothed by glacial action. The engravings here represent two phases of carving. The first phast presents engravings from the Neolithic Age (4th millennium BC), with 28 praying figures, of which several can be seen here on the 3D model. They have both schematic and curved arms. These are contemporary with the circle motifs with a dot in the centre and two figures recognisable as halberds. The second phase starts from the Middle IronAge and the panel is densely engraved with figures of warriors wielding swords, shields & spears. The rock also displays some historic phase motifs, with filiforms of lines, half-circles and grids and some Medieval crosses.
